Kahoku ( Japanese か ほ く 市 , - shi ) is a city in Ishikawa Prefecture on the island of Honshū in Japan .
geography
Kahoku is north of Kanazawa and south of Wajima on the Sea of Japan .

history
Kahoku was created on March 1, 2004 through the merger of the communities of Unoke ( 宇 ノ 気 町 , -machi ), Nanatsuka ( 七 塚 町 , -machi ) and Takamatsu ( 高 松 町 , -machi ) of Kahoku County .
Attractions
In the city is the "Ishikawa Nishida Kitaro Museum of Philosophy" (西 田 幾多 郎 記念 哲学 管, Nishida Kitarō kinen tetsugaku-kan).
